Contact Outback Concepts
Send Us a Message
Send Us a Message
Service Area
Oklahoma City, OK
Tulsa, OK
Lawton, OK
Contact Us
OKC Location:
Call or Text: 405-517-6077
Tulsa Location:
Call or Text: 918-934-8710
Business Hours
Mon - Thurs 8:00 am - 5:00 pm
Fri 8:00 am - 12:00 pm
Sat - Sun Closed
Saturdays by appointment only.
We are closed the last week of the year.
Associations
Elite Pro Dealer for Universal Screens
Member of NHBA
Brands
Universal Screens
Four Season Building Products
Trex Decking & Railing
Temo Sunroom
ABC Supply Co. Inc
Bull
Alumawood
Share On: